Transaction e346c3fcc83a028c4b707df76e4a1203e5ba7877fd4d110ea317a51eb5129e43

36 Input
2 Outputs
  • e346c3fcc83a028c4b707df76e4a1203e5ba7877fd4d110ea317a51eb5129e43:0
  • value  284223030
    address  1DR7rixkGNaJYijpNohsssaYd5c72kFSuL
  • e346c3fcc83a028c4b707df76e4a1203e5ba7877fd4d110ea317a51eb5129e43:1
  • value  44890590511
    address  3Ay3khQqAE781wyzZtzRN9yqMB1r57Jmck